API de Personalización
UnicoThemeBuilder methods
| Método | Descripción |
|---|---|
setColorSilhouetteSuccess(color) | Color de la silueta cuando la captura es exitosa |
setBackgroundColor(color) | Color de fondo del marco de captura |
setColorText(color) | Color del texto |
setBackgroundColorComponents(color) | Color de fondo de los componentes de UI |
setColorTextComponents(color) | Color del texto dentro de los componentes de UI |
setBackgroundColorBoxMessage(color) | Color de fondo del cuadro de mensaje |
setColorTextBoxMessage(color) | Color del texto dentro del cuadro de mensaje |
setBackgroundColorButtons(color) | Color de fondo de los botones |
setColorTextButtons(color) | Color del texto de los botones |
setColorCancelButton(color) | Color del botón de cancelar |
setColorProgressBar(color) | Color de la barra de progreso |
setFontFamily(font) (v3.19.2+) | Familia tipográfica para el marco de captura |
setHtmlPopupLoading(html) | HTML personalizado para el popup de carga (solo captura de documentos) |
build() | Retorna la instancia de UnicoTheme |
Tipos de valores de color
Los tipos de color admitidos son cadenas hexadecimales (p. ej., "#FF0000").
Locale
| Método | Tipo | Descripción |
|---|---|---|
setLocale(locale) | LocaleTypes | Establece el idioma de la pantalla de captura |
Consulta Referencia de API > Enums para ver la lista completa de valores de LocaleTypes admitidos.